Steamboat at a glance

Steamboat sits in Colorado with 3,668 ft of vertical drop, 169 trails, and 2,965 skiable acres. Steamboat skews toward experienced skiers. About 44% of the mountain is advanced terrain. Terrain park on site.

The mountain averages 349" of snowfall per season with 380 GPM of snowmaking capacity. Lift tickets start around $265; day-of pricing varies. Steamboat is a Ikon Pass mountain.
